Shift Differential Definition

A payment made to employees in addition to the standard wages to compensate for the inconvenience of working unpopular shifts. Usually a shift differential is offered to employees working in evening and midnight (second and third) shifts.

Shift Differential Extended Definition
A shift differential is additional pay offered as reward for working outside usual daytime or weekday shifts. Such arrangements are common in sectors like health care, retail, manufacturing, and other establishments that operate 24/7.
